Characteristics and tasting notes of the Garance Blanc de Noirs 2012 by Thiénot
Tasting
Nose
Particularly expressive and remarkably complex, it reveals aromas of ripe yellow fruits and mirabelle plum, interwoven with notes of dried fruits. Touches of dark citrus, dried flowers, sweet spices and roasted coffee further enrich this bouquet.
Palate
Dynamic and endowed with an impressive structure, it offers beautiful minerality along with remarkable depth. The whole remains highly elegant, stretching towards a savoury, long and taut finish.
Food and wine pairings
This cuvée pairs wonderfully with delicate meats such as spring lamb or Bresse poultry. It also perfectly accompanies a pan-fried medley of wild mushrooms, a cooked pressed cheese such as an aged Comté matured for 24 months, or a red fruit dessert such as a cherry tart.
Serving and cellaring
To fully appreciate the Garance Blanc de Noirs 2012, it is recommended to serve it at a temperature between 8 and 10°C. This wine has a cellaring potential of over 10 years.

The estate
Founded in 1985 by Alain Thiénot, a former broker, Champagne Thiénot is a family-owned and independent estate located in the heart of Reims. Today, his children, Garance and Stanislas Thiénot, lead the estate and oversee a vineyard of around 30 hectares, mainly classified as grand cru and premier cru. This contemporary house stands out for its boldness and its deep roots in historic terroirs, offering wines that brilliantly combine Champagne tradition with modernity.
The vineyard
The grapes used for this cuvée mainly come from the Montagne de Reims, an essential terroir of Champagne. Sourcing relies on a rigorous selection of prestigious terroirs, with around 30% of villages classified as grand cru, such as Aÿ and Mailly, and 55% of premiers crus including Taissy, Avenay-Val-d'Or, Mareuil-sur-Aÿ and Cumières. A few plots located in Les Riceys complete this high-quality set.
The vintage
The 2012 year was marked by climatic conditions that favoured a rich and intense harvest. This vintage yielded berries with great aromatic maturity while retaining a beautifully natural tension, thus offering an ideal balance between concentration and freshness.
Winemaking and ageing
The making of the Garance Blanc de Noirs 2012 begins with a fully completed malolactic fermentation. After bottling in May 2013, the bottles benefit from a long ageing on lees of nine years in the historic cellars of the house in Reims. The late disgorgement took place in September 2022.
Grape varieties
This blend is composed of 90% Pinot Noir and 10% Pinot Meunier.
